## Account Recovery — Trailnote Offline Mode

When a surveyor's Trailnote app has been offline for 30+ days, their local credentials expire and sync refuses to resume. Don't make them wipe the device — all their unsynced field data lives there! Instead, open the support console, pick "Offline Reinstate," and enter their handle. The console will ask for the support team's shared recovery passphrase before issuing a reinstatement token. Use the one below.

unlock words, bagaf-fajeg: zorael-kelax-fraath-quenix-eliok-sileth-aldmir-wenir-druiel

Runbook: Promoting firmware to the stable channel.

All Lanternbox device firmware moves through beta → canary → stable. Before promotion, confirm the canary fleet has run the candidate build for 72 hours with no rollback events in the Wickfield dashboard. Then tag the build, generate the manifest, and push it to the stable channel endpoint. The update service rejects any manifest that isn't signed, so sign it with the channel deploy key, shown below:

release key, fajef-kajeg: bky19_LdLu6Ne6FLi8he2c24d

## Releases

Compaction builds for Quillpipe ship every other Friday. Each release includes the compactor binary plus the tombstone-cleanup patch notes — worth skimming before you field tickets about "missing" old messages (that's compaction working, not data loss). Verify any downloaded release against our public signing key, shown below.

deploy key for kajof-fajop: bky6_gDHw9Q

// MAX_FUEL_REPORT_ROWS caps the rows exported by the Thornvale fleet
// fuel-usage report. Security note: raising this limit increases the
// blast radius of a leaked export, since rows include depot locations
// and route timing. Any change requires sign-off from the data-handling
// review board. The value was last audited under the build noted below.

pipeline stamp: htk6_c0ef30